Ever since Amaranth, all of a sudden you have energy trader wanabees coming out of the woodwork.

Avg salary is peanuts, but you rake in alot of dough as compensatio IF you put in enough effort and research and develop your own particular 'edge' in the market like Mr Hunter did with natural gas spreads. :P

Progression would also be solely based on your performance.

Unlike IB, trading lays alot more emphasis on individual performance than lets say number of deals done by the whole team etc.

Also, a quant background is really helpfull. What have you studied?
